In a previous study [Alahari, Lee and Juliano (2000) J. Cell Biol. 151, 1141-1154], we have identified a novel protein, nischarin, that specifically interacts with the cytoplasmic tail of the alpha5 integrin subunit. Overexpression of this protein profoundly affects cell migration. To examine the nischarin-alpha5 interaction in detail, and to find the minimal region required for the interaction, several mutants of nischarin and alpha5 were created. The results obtained for the yeast two-hybrid system indicate that a 99-aminoacid region of nischarin (from residues 464 to 562) is indispensable for the interaction. Also, we demonstrate that the membrane proximal region (from residues 1017 to 1030) of the alpha5 cytoplasmic tail is essential for the interaction. To characterize more directly the properties of the interaction between nischarin and alpha5, we performed surface-plasmon resonance studies in which peptides were immobilized on the surface of a sensor chip, and the recombinant nischarin protein fragments were injected. Consistent with the two-hybrid results, recombinant nischarin binds well to immobilized alpha5 peptides. In addition, mutational analysis revealed that residues Tyr(1018) and Lys(1022) are crucial for alpha5-nischarin interactions. These results provide evidence that nischarin is capable of directly and selectively binding to a portion of the alpha5 cytoplasmic domain. Further studies demonstrated that the minimal alpha5 binding region of nischarin does not affect cell migration.
